摘要:
今天用实例总结一下group by的用法。归纳一下:group by:ALL ,Cube,RollUP,Compute,Compute by创建数据脚本Create Table SalesInfo(Ctiy nvarchar(50),OrderDate datetime,OrderID int)in... 阅读全文
2014年10月18日
2014年10月16日
摘要:
最近遇到了一个问题就是 一个执行速度很快的存储过程,在代码中调用的时候却超时了。后来看到了两篇文章:其中一篇是这样介绍的今天同事用代码调用存储过程时超时,在SQL Server Management Studio里运行却很快就有结果,这和我上次遇到的情况一下,现在将解决方案记录如下,谨为大家作一提醒... 阅读全文
2014年10月8日
摘要:
固定服务器角色 描述 sysadmin 可以在SQLServer 中执行任何活动。 serveradmin 可以设置服务器范围的配置选项,关闭服务器。 setupadmin 可以管理链接服务器和启动过程。 securityadmin 可以管理登录和CREATE DATA... 阅读全文
2014年10月3日
摘要:
由于想总结的东西比较杂乱,就起了这么一个题目1.当还原数据库,没有选择结尾日志备份时,会出现下图异常:这是因为,对于使用完全恢复模式或大容量日志恢复模式的数据库,在大多数情况下,您必须在还原数据库前备份日志的结尾。如果想不抛出这个错误就需要选择 覆盖现有数据库(With Replace)。使用 RE... 阅读全文
2014年9月26日
摘要:
准备:日志截断在下列情况下发生:1、执行完BACKUPLOG语句时。2、在每次处理检查点时(如果数据库使用的是简单恢复模式)。这包括CHECKPOINT语句所产生的显式检查点和系统生成的隐式检查点。例外情况是如果检查点发生在BACKUP语句仍活动时,则不截断日志开始:Sqlserver的恢复模式包括... 阅读全文
2014年9月24日
摘要:
在SQL Server中有一个非常重要的命令就是CheckPoint,它主要作用是把缓存中的数据写入mdf文件中。其实在我们进行insert, update, delete时,数据并没有直接写入数据库对应的mdf文件中,而是写入了缓存里,这有点像电驴,因为过于频繁的写入会使磁盘的寿命大大减小。从上图... 阅读全文
2014年8月29日
摘要:
我看先看一个例子:public class A{ public int a = 10; public virtual void Fun1() { Console.WriteLine("1"); -------A1 } public virtual void Fun3() { Console.Writ... 阅读全文
2014年8月25日
摘要:
关于C#中派生类调用基类构造函数的理解 .c#class 本文中的默认构造函数是指在没有编写构造函数的情况下系统默认的无参构造函数1、 当基类中没有自己编写构造函数时,派生类默认的调用基类的默认构造函数Ex: public class MyBaseClass { } public class MyD... 阅读全文
2014年8月14日
摘要:
1.sp_spaceused :sp_spaceused table_name---------------------------------------------------------------------------------------------name rows reserved... 阅读全文
2014年7月23日
摘要:
源码待续。。。 阅读全文